After surviving being kicked out last Sunday, the wildcards, Pere and Maria were exclusively asked to nominate 4 housemates each for eviction.

JAYPAUL was among those nominated for possible eviction but he was saved by the Head Of the House, Boma, who replaced him with Yousef.

The following Contestants are now up for eviction on Sunday:

1 Beatrice
2 Yerins
3 Whitemoney
4 Yousef
5 Niyi

Yusuf Buhari, the son of the Nigerian President is set to tie the knot with the second daughter of the Emir of Bichi, Zahra Ado-Bayero, on the 20th of August, 2021.

As the wedding is fast approaching, the soon-to-be couple have started their prewedding festivities with a special Polo Tournament.

The Polo Tournament was organised by their friends and family during the weekend, and was attended by some friends and family members of the couple.

The tournament was also graced by the newlywed daughter of the Bauchi State Governor, Fatima Zahra Bala and her husband, Malah Sheriff.

Yusuf Buhari who is the only surviving son of the Nigerian President, Muhammadu Buhari, graduated from the University of Surrey, Guildford, United Kingdom in 2016 with his sister Zahra

Bayero was born in 1299 AH (1881). He received his early Islamic education at the Sarki’s palace and he was guided by the prominent Islamic scholars of his time.

He was appointed Sarki Kano in April 1926 and was formally installed on 14 February 1927.

Kano city was the first place in the North to have electricity and a water supply on a large scale. This was chiefly the result of the initiative of Abdullahi Bayero, who proposed in 1927 that surplus funds in the Native Administration accounts be used to provide an electricity and a water supply for the whole of Kano. Until then, these services had been supplied only to the Government area

Sarki Kano Abdullahi Bayero was the first Sarki to perform the Hajj, hence he is popularly known as Sarki Alhaji. He was accompanied on this journey by his younger brother Galadima Abdulkadir and Ma’aji Mallam Sulaiman, who later became the first Walin Kano.
